Output e4d8943774e8d10cd2f11c036448386ba2033e571127a151d0c4465448f8227e:5

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e865bfb882e4a03c79ecc456a862ac37b5f536 OP_EQUAL
address
3C5JgUjUohNV2D4eV8N2Yzz7cs33h2vZbf
transaction
e4d8943774e8d10cd2f11c036448386ba2033e571127a151d0c4465448f8227e
spent
true